Unlike its low stakes counterpart, high stakes roulette presents a unique⁤ set of⁤ strategies and dynamics. Players frequently ⁤enough choose​ from a range of bets, including:

  • Inside Bets: ⁣Higher payouts but⁢ lower winning probability.
  • Outside Bets: Safer options‍ with a higher chance of winning.
  • Call​ Bets: A blend⁣ of both strategies, providing diverse options.

To visualize the​ impact of⁤ high stakes betting, consider the following table comparing typical payouts:

Bet Type Payout Winning probability
Single Number 35 to ⁣1 2.63%
Color (Red/Black) 1 to 1 48.6%
Odd/Even 1 to 1 48.6%

This table illustrates that while high‍ stakes betting can offer impressive returns, the odds ‍vary ⁤significantly, prompting strategic thinking and calculated risk-taking. ⁣Ultimately, the choice of whether to engage in high stakes or low stakes roulette ‍lies in personal⁣ preference, risk appetite, and overall gaming ideology.

The Benefits of Low Stakes ‍Play for ⁢Newcomers

For newcomers to the exhilarating world of‌ roulette, starting with low‌ stakes can be a game-changer. it allows players to familiarize themselves with the rules, flow, and atmosphere without the weighty pressure of notable financial loss. This relaxed environment fosters a more enjoyable​ experience where⁣ the focus⁣ can ‍shift from mere winning to understanding the nuances of the game. Engaging in low stakes play also provides‌ a valuable opportunity to practice various betting strategies, helping novice ⁤players to build confidence before ⁣stepping up their bets.

Moreover, low‍ stakes roulette acts as a gateway to developing crucial skills and instincts ‌for future high-stakes encounters. ‍by observing game patterns and the behavior ​of other players, newcomers can ​glean essential insights that‌ may aid in ‌decision-making. The benefits of this learning ‍phase are enhanced by the following factors:

  • Reduced emotional stress: Lower financial stakes mean ​lower anxiety.
  • Learning curve: More chances to refine strategies without financial strain.
  • Social interaction: Opportunities to engage with other players in a low-pressure setting.

Risk management Strategies for Different Betting Levels

When engaging in high-stakes ⁣roulette, effective risk management is paramount. ⁤Players should adopt⁢ a strategic approach to ​maximize their chances while minimizing​ potential losses.​ Here are some key strategies to​ consider:

  • Bankroll ⁤Management: ⁣ Set ⁢a ​strict budget and stick to it, ensuring‌ that‍ your bankroll can withstand the volatility of high stakes.
  • Time Limits: establish a time frame for each session, as prolonged play can lead to impulsive ⁢decisions and financial strain.
  • Targeted Bets: Focus ‍on bets with better odds, such as outside‍ bets (even/odd, red/black)‍ to maintain steady wins rather than chasing⁢ larger payouts.

In contrast, low-stakes ⁢roulette⁤ offers a different landscape, where the risk is generally more manageable but ‌strategies remain essential for success. Players ⁢can employ‍ the following tactics:

  • Incremental Betting: ⁤ Increase your bets gradually based on wins, allowing a cushion against losses and prolonging gameplay.
  • Play for Longer: The lower stakes‌ allow for extended playtime, providing more opportunities to understand patterns and improve skills.
  • Casual⁢ Approach: ‌Embrace a relaxed mindset, using low-stakes bets as a fun way to explore the ⁢game‌ without heavy ‍financial pressure.
